The L-1A nonimmigrant classification enables an U.S. employer to transfer an executive or supervisor from among its associated foreign offices to one of its workplaces in the USA. This classification also enables an international company that does not yet have an associated united state workplace to send an executive or supervisor to the USA with the objective of establishing one.suggests the normal, systematic, and constant provision of goods and/or solutions by a certifying organization and does not include the simple visibility of a representative or office of the qualifying company in the USA and abroad. To certify, the called employee should likewise: Typically have been helping a qualifying organization abroad for one constant year within the 3 years right away preceding his or her admission to the United States; andBe seeking to get in the USA to offer solution in an exec or supervisory capacity for a branch of the exact same employer or one of its certifying organizations.
typically refers to the capability of the employee to oversee and manage the job of expert workers and to manage the company, or a division, community, feature, or component of the organization. It may likewise refer to the worker's capability to take care of an essential feature of the organization at a high level, without straight supervision of others.

Qualified workers going into the United States to develop a brand-new workplace will certainly be permitted a maximum first stay of one year. For all L-1A workers, requests for extension of keep may be given in increments of up to an additional two years, up until the employee has gotten to the optimum restriction of seven years.

The L-1 visa is for intracompany transferees employees that have actually functioned abroad for a parent, associate or subsidiary of the U.S. firm for at least one year within the preceding 3 years. The job abroad must have remained in a supervisory or executive capacity or has to have entailed specialized knowledge, and the job to be performed in the USA should remain in one of these 3 capabilities, although not always the very same one.

The united state sponsor firm should demonstrate it has a qualifying relationship in between it and the parent, associate, or webpage subsidiary abroad; indicating the U.S. or foreign company holds at least 50% ownership in the other business. The employee should reveal that s/he has benefited the company abroad for at the very least one year full-time in a certifying role.

Persons certifying as an L-1A have an expedited path to a "Permit" as they have the ability to bypass the labor accreditation filing, and they qualify in an EB-1 category, which is higher choice classification that is hardly ever subjected to backlogs for the majority of countries (with the exemption of India and China).
Individuals pertaining to open up a brand-new office in the U.S. are just eligible for an initial one-year remain in the united state. The USCIS will likewise typically look at business plan of the company, and review the potential customers for future success of the operation both in the first demand and at the time of revival.
